Hi, would anyone have the part codes handy for ordering new rear Amvar struts for a 2007 C6? I didnt find any reference to them In the sites technical section. I found a parts list for the front struts. Real pity the online Citroen catalogue is no longer available. Very handy reference for parts. Thanks again if anyone has the codes needed. 321Dave |

Hi 321Dave, I hope that it is this: 5272.A0 also there is a codes 5272.80 and 5272.94 I can upload photo just tell me how, I tryed but without results. Regards |

cruiserphil wrote ... Hello 321Dave, Did it fail NCT for rear suspension? Best regards, Phil C. Hi Phil, It did unfortunately. And again on the retest recently. It has a problem with the driver side rear shock. It’s not hard or anything i cant feel anything wrong with it, but on the nct test setup it has a failing value for the offside rear axle 48 left and 97mm right side and a 51% overall imbalance for the rear. Same result when i had it retested. Passed on all other tests fine. Then Covid struck and I’m just now trying to get it nct ready for September if possible. Any thoughts on it Phil? I was thinking if one of the sensors was off, would it effect the strut being tested? But i have no sensor codes or issues relating to the rear suspension. |

Could be one of your rear spheres is well down on gas pressure, rather than anything being wrong with the strut. | ||

Hello 321 Dave, I'd be with Hattershaun on the sphere pressure as the first area to check. Nobody here in Ireland appears to be sure what the Mm unit is on the NCT report sheet (like SEEM units Citroen used for timing belt tension). But if it helps, both our cars were in the 34 - 40 Mm range for rear suspension when last tested. Did you try the trick of driving slowly at an angle over a speed ramp to detect imbalance in the rear? Best regards, Phil C. |

Hello 321Dave, I just found when you come over the ramp at an angle you can compare the reaction of each side as the car rocks and sense if one side is stiffer than the other. Best regards, Phil C. |
